Does this sound like your idea of a great job? If so, Kirby Risk has an opening for a Technical Sales Consultant- Process Automation Solutions to cover its Rockwell Automation Business in Indiana, Illinois, and NW Ohio.
What will I do as a Technical Sales Consultant for Process Automation Solutions?
- Be the single point of contact to drive and expand the Industrial Process Automation Business for all of Kirby Risk
- Sell business outcomes by establishing advisory relationships with Executives and Senior level leaders
- Create and execute an annual Process Solutions plan with strategy and objectives
- Lead the sales process in identifying Industrial Process Automation Solution opportunities, along with working with Regional Sales Managers and Regional Automation Managers to align the organization's teams.
- Understand and analyze the Process market, conditions, competitors, threats, and opportunities
- Plan and participate in Quarterly Business Reviews
- Develop Process Solutions competency plans for the organizaorganization'seams
- Escalates business issues, commercial and technical, with Rockwell and other vendor partners to improve both the distributor and customer experience
Want to know if you are a good fit? If so, you will meet the following criteria:- Engineering Degree or qualified engineering experience
- Understanding and knowledge of modern Process DCS. (Foxboro, Delta V, Baillie, Rockwell Automation PlantPAX)
- 5+ years of strategic sales and consulting experience
- Exceptional analytical and problem-solving skills
- Solid consultative selling experience
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ills, interpersonal communication, customer contact skills, and the ability to interact with people at all levels of the organization
- Advanced computer skills and aptitude; Microsoft Office Suite preferred
- Demonstrated ability to influence leadership thinking
